Abstract

Tetraaza macrocycles and their Fe3+ complexes have been prepared and characterized by elemental analysis, i.r., n.m.r., and e.s.–m.s. spectroscopic techniques. The solution behaviour of the macrocycles and their complexes was studied by potentiometric titrations.
